C语言:数组中进行查找操作什么意思

C语言:数组中进行查找操作什么意思

查找的意义是在一堆数据中,使用方法找到你想要找的数据。一般为分:顺序和折半(又叫二分)查找两种方法。存放在数组中的数据就可以看成一堆数据,在有限数组内存放一些数据,通过使用查找方法进行查找想要找的数。顺序方法:这种查找方法不需要数组排序,数
Python140
C语言中数组的用途有哪些?

C语言中数组的用途有哪些?

数组,顾名思义,是相同类型的数组成的一个组,也就是说是把相同类型的一系列数据统一编制到某一个组别中。这样就可以通过数组名+索引号简单快捷的操作大量数据。这就和全校学生一样,把学生分成多个班级,每个学生都是班级中的一员,如果要找张三,如果没
Python170
C如何输出数组

C如何输出数组

1、首先先简单定义一个整形的数组int[] nums = { 1, 2, 3, 4, 5, 6 }。2、之后先用常规的for循环来输出数组中的元素,for (int i = 0i &ltnums.Lengthi++)  其中 i &
Python90
Go语言数组去重

Go语言数组去重

在使用Go语言的时候,碰到了需要对数组进行去重操作的问题。Java语言有Set集合这个数据结构,可以很方便的将数组转为集合,但是Go语言没有Set,如果仅仅是因为去重操作就手动实现一个Set太繁琐了。可以根据Go语言中的map的特性来简单实
Python140
java数组怎么声明

java数组怎么声明

1. java中定义一个字符串数组方式如下,string类型和其他基本类型相似,创建数组有两种方式 :String[] str={"AAA","BBB","CCC"}String
Python170
c语言能替代r语言吗

c语言能替代r语言吗

不能。R为解释性语言,不需要编译,C需要编译,其次两种语言下标起始不同;R的下标从1开始,C从0开始。还有就是两者构造不同,R是用C和Fortran写成的软件,因此c语言不能替代r语言。R是已经建好的一栋高楼,能够实现居住或者办公的功能。而
Python130
c语言中的折半排序法是怎样的,基本程序是怎样的

c语言中的折半排序法是怎样的,基本程序是怎样的

折半法应该叫做2分法。用2分法查找数需要先对数组进行排序(升序或降序)假如你所要查找的数是20数组是 1 4 7 8 2030 34每次都拿中间的数跟你要比的数比也就是 8和20比发现20比8大所以左面的数都不要了剩下的是 20 30
Python150
C语言寻找矩阵的鞍点

C语言寻找矩阵的鞍点

1、鞍点为矩阵元素所在行的最大值,以及所在列的最小值。2、首先,定义3个整型变量,保存控制循环的变量,以及标志是否有鞍点。3、接着,定义三个整型数组变量,保存矩阵各元素,以及每一行的最大值和每一列的最小值。4、设置最大值数组和最小值数组的初
Python140
java数组怎么声明

java数组怎么声明

1. java中定义一个字符串数组方式如下,string类型和其他基本类型相似,创建数组有两种方式 :String[] str={"AAA","BBB","CCC"}String
Python130
java for循环用法

java for循环用法

java for循环用法如下:javafor循环语句语法:for(初始化布尔表达式更新) { 代码语句}。最先执行初始化步骤,可以声明一种类型,但可初始化一个或多个循环控制变量,也可以是空语句。然后,检测布尔表达式的值:1、如果为 t
Python270
go语言:数组

go语言:数组

数组是一个由固定长度的特定类型元素组成的序列,一个数组可以由零个或多个元素组成。数组是值类型 数组的每个元素都可以通过索引下标来访问,索引下标的范围是从0开始到数组长度减1的位置,内置函数 len() 可以
Python150
c语言能替代r语言吗

c语言能替代r语言吗

不能。R为解释性语言,不需要编译,C需要编译,其次两种语言下标起始不同;R的下标从1开始,C从0开始。还有就是两者构造不同,R是用C和Fortran写成的软件,因此c语言不能替代r语言。R是已经建好的一栋高楼,能够实现居住或者办公的功能。而
Python100
c语言能替代r语言吗

c语言能替代r语言吗

不能。R为解释性语言,不需要编译,C需要编译,其次两种语言下标起始不同;R的下标从1开始,C从0开始。还有就是两者构造不同,R是用C和Fortran写成的软件,因此c语言不能替代r语言。R是已经建好的一栋高楼,能够实现居住或者办公的功能。而
Python170